1 #ifndef ALIMUONCHAMBERTRIGGER_H
2 #define ALIMUONCHAMBERTRIGGER_H
4 /* Copyright(c) 1998-1999, ALICE Experiment at CERN, All rights reserved. *
5 * See cxx source for full Copyright notice */
8 // Revision of includes 07/05/2004
11 /// \class AliMUONChamberTrigger
12 /// \brief Muon trigger chamber class
14 #include "AliMUONChamber.h"
16 class AliMUONClusterFinder;
17 class AliMUONSegmentationTrigger;
18 class AliMUONResponseTrigger;
19 class AliMUONResponseTriggerV1;
20 class AliMUONGeometryTransformer;
23 class AliMUONChamberTrigger : public AliMUONChamber
26 AliMUONChamberTrigger();
27 AliMUONChamberTrigger(Int_t id, const AliMUONGeometryTransformer* kGeometry);
28 virtual ~AliMUONChamberTrigger();
30 // Cluster formation method (charge disintegration)
32 virtual void DisIntegration(AliMUONHit* hit,
33 Int_t& nnew, Float_t newclust[6][500]);
36 AliMUONChamberTrigger(const AliMUONChamberTrigger& right);
37 AliMUONChamberTrigger& operator = (const AliMUONChamberTrigger& right);
39 const AliMUONGeometryTransformer* fkGeomTransformer;///< geometry transformations
41 ClassDef(AliMUONChamberTrigger,2) // Muon trigger chamber class